准备工作是至关重要的,它涉及到必要的安排和准备,以确保顺利进行,在这个过程中,不应有任何多余的内容或延误。
PHP MySQL 数据读取详解:如何正确读取 MySQL 数据库中的数据 在现代的 web 开发中,PHP 和 MySQL 的结合是非常常见的,PHP 是一种流行的服务器端脚本语言,而 MySQL 是一个流行的关系数据库管理系统,为了从 MySQL 数据库中读取数据,我们需要使用 PHP 来编写代码,本文将详细介绍如何使用 PHP 来读取 MySQL 数据库中的数据。
在开始之前,请确保你已经完成了以下准备工作:
- 已经安装了 PHP 和 MySQL,并且能够在你的服务器上运行它们。
- 已经创建了一个 MySQL 数据库,并且知道如何连接到它。
- 了解基本的 PHP 语法和 MySQL 数据库的基本概念。
连接 MySQL 数据库
在 PHP 中,我们需要使用 mysqli 或 PDO 扩展来连接 MySQL 数据库,以下是使用 mysqli 扩展连接到 MySQL 数据库的示例代码:
<?php
$servername = "localhost"; // 数据库服务器名称
$username = "username"; // 数据库用户名
$password = "password"; // 数据库密码
$dbname = "myDB"; // 数据库名称
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接是否成功
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>
读取数据
连接到数据库后,我们可以使用 SQL 查询来读取数据,以下是一个简单的示例,展示如何从数据库中读取数据:
<?php
// 执行查询语句
$sql = "SELECT id, name FROM myTable"; // 查询表中的 id 和 name 列的数据
$result = $conn->query($sql); // 执行查询并获取结果集对象
if ($result->num_rows > 0) { // 检查是否有数据返回
while($row = $result->fetch_assoc()) { // 循环遍历结果集并输出每一行数据
echo "ID: " . $row["id"]. " - Name: " . $row["name"]. "<br>"; // 输出每一行的数据内容
}
} else { // 如果没有数据返回,输出相应的提示信息
echo "没有找到数据"; // 输出提示信息或执行其他逻辑处理操作,根据实际情况进行修改。"; 如果没有找到数据,则输出相应的提示信息或执行其他逻辑处理操作,根据实际情况进行修改。"; echo "没有找到数据"; } ?> 五、关闭数据库连接 在完成数据库操作后,我们需要关闭数据库连接以释放资源,可以使用以下代码关闭连接: <?php $conn->close(); ?> 六、本文介绍了如何使用 PHP 来读取 MySQL 数据库中的数据,我们介绍了准备工作和如何连接到 MySQL 数据库,我们展示了如何使用 SQL 查询语句来读取数据,并遍历结果集输出每一行的数据内容,我们强调了在完成数据库操作后关闭数据库连接的重要性,希望本文能够帮助你理解 PHP MySQL 数据读取的基本原理和操作方法,在实际开发中,你可以根据具体需求进行扩展和修改代码以满足你的需求。